What Are Link Sharing Communities?Link sharing communities are online platforms where people share links to valuable articles, guides, videos, or other resources. The goal is to inform, engage, and support members of a specific niche or professional group.
Unlike regular social media platforms, these communities focus on curated information rather than personal updates. Members submit links they find useful, discuss topics, and vote for or recommend quality content.
Common examples include:
- LinkedIn Groups related to specific industries
- GrowthHackers, a platform where marketers share strategies and case studies
- Reddit subcommunities like r/B2Bmarketing, r/SEO, or r/Entrepreneur
- Hacker News for tech and startup discussions
- Product Hunt, where companies share new tools and products
- BizSugar and Inbound.org style platforms for small businesses and marketers
How Link Sharing Communities WorkMost link sharing platforms follow a similar structure:
- Submission: A user shares a link to an article, product, or resource.
- Engagement: Other members comment, like, or vote based on content quality.
- Visibility: Highly rated or discussed links appear more prominently, getting more attention.
- Networking: Members connect, follow, and interact based on shared interests.
- Trust Building: Regular contributors gain recognition and credibility within the community.

How to Choose the Right Link Sharing Communities for Your BusinessSelecting the correct platforms is essential to get measurable results. Not every community will align with your business goals or audience type.
Here are key factors to consider:
- Industry Focus: Choose platforms centered on your domain. For instance, if you sell HR software, use communities for HR professionals or business operations.
- User Demographics: Evaluate who participates—marketers, executives, developers, or startups.
- Engagement Level: Active communities with discussions offer better reach than inactive ones.
- Content Rules: Each community has posting guidelines. Avoid spam or self-promotion to maintain a positive reputation.
- Relevancy of Topics: Make sure your shared links directly serve the audience’s interests.

How to Use Link Sharing Communities EffectivelyMerely posting links is not enough. Your participation should be intentional, ethical, and audience-focused. Here are strategic methods to use these communities efficiently.
1. Share Valuable, Educational ContentAlways put value first. Links that solve problems, explain new ideas, or offer helpful resources get more attention. Avoid overtly promotional articles.
2. Participate in DiscussionsEngage beyond posting. Comment on others’ submissions, ask questions, or offer insights. This builds respect among members and encourages reciprocity.
3. Follow Community GuidelinesEach platform has its culture and posting frequency. Respect the rules to maintain trust and avoid being flagged as spam.
4. Create Catchy but Relevant TitlesYour post title often determines whether people click. Make it direct and informative rather than clickbait. Focus on clear messaging that highlights value.
5. Monitor AnalyticsUse UTM tracking or analytics tools to measure which platforms drive the most engagement or conversions. This data helps refine your community strategy over time.
6. Stay ConsistentVisibility depends on regular participation. Posting once or twice a week with quality content keeps your brand active without overwhelming the community.

Measuring Success in Link SharingTo evaluate whether your efforts are paying off, track key metrics that reveal engagement and growth.
Metric | What It Shows | How to Measure |
| Click-through rate | How many people click your shared links | Use UTM tags |
| Referral traffic | Volume of traffic from platform users | Google Analytics |
| Engagement | Votes, comments, or shares | Platform stats |
| Follower growth | How your profile or brand recognition grows | Platform analytics |
| Conversion rate | Leads or actions from community traffic | CRM or campaign tracking |
Challenges to Keep in MindWhile link sharing offers many advantages, B2B businesses must approach it carefully.
Common challenges include:
- Time Investment: Building a presence takes consistent participation, not quick fixes.
- Community Sensitivity: Over-promotion can damage your reputation.
- Content Fatigue: Repeated low-value posts get ignored quickly.
- Algorithm Changes: Some platforms adjust visibility rules, affecting reach.
- Measuring ROI: Community-driven growth often brings long-term rather than immediate returns.
